Cannot copy/ paste within a table when using Table Plus Macro

The Table Plus Macro is ideal for filtering, but it doesn't work very well and the bob swift confluence pages with documentation are not accessible unless you have some type of special account.

Anyway,  the problems are that you cannot copy/paste which is a fundamental need.  Is anyone else having this issue when using the Table Plus macro and do you have a solution?

 

Also, the table size doesn't match the size you see in the edit mode.  After publishing, the table size will often shrink quite a bit, making it not as readable.

I encountered this problem, too, exactly as you describe it. 

There doesn't seem to be anything to do about the table resizing issue. 

I did find a partial workaround for pasting text into the table while it's nested in a macro, by using "past as plain text" (Ctrl+Shft+V). The text is inserted at the cursor location. Of course, you lose all formatting and need to re-add links. 

In my case, I needed to make the content available for review, and having it inside a macro was too complicated. We copied the table and pasted it outside the macro for review, and then when we were done, I inserted it into the macro again. 

This is definitely an area that Atlassian should work on: i.e., ensuring that content inside a macro behaves and can be manipulated in all the ways content outside of macros can be.
